Arsene Wenger insists Barcelona should not be allowed to join the Premier League.

Barca president Josep Maria Bartomeu has admitted the club will consider playing outside of Spain if Catalonia gains independence.

And his comments were backed up by La Liga chief Javier Tebas over the weekend, who conceded he could see the league going forward without the Nou Camp giants.

It has led to suggestions that Barca could play in the Premier League but Wenger is not having in it.

The Arsenal boss believes it would make much more sense for Celtic or Rangers to enter the English game.

"I hope Barcelona continue playing in Spain. It would break the geographical unity and common sense," he told beIN Sports.

"Why don't they invite Celtic or Rangers to the Premier League who are already part of Great Britain, that would have more sense than inviting Barcelona.

"On the other hand if the politics between Spain and Catalonia don't go well it would signify support from England for Catalonia and that would not be welcomed internationally."

Last month, Football League clubs ruled out the chances of Celtic or Rangers entering a new structure.

All 72 clubs held talks on switching from three 24-team divisions to four leagues of 20 - allowing for Premier League B teams and potentially the Old Firm clubs.
